Immerse yourself in the charm and sophistication of this large cape home, tucked in the sought-after neighborhood of Eltingville, Staten Island. With its inviting curb appeal, the property introduces you to a beautifully renovated and impeccably maintained two-story home.Three spacious bedrooms grace this residence - an upstairs primary suite offering a private oasis complete with a full bath, and two additional comfortable bedrooms nestled downstairs. Each room is a testament to the thoughtful design and attention to detail that characterizes this home.At the home's heart, you'll find an open concept living room and kitchen area. This space, fully renovated ten years ago, is a harmonious blend of comfort and modern design with an abundance of cabinetry and quality appliances. Adjacent to this, you have a bonus dining room, ideal for entertaining or quiet family meals.The home's bathroom, updated two years ago, offers a serene retreat with its blend of modern aesthetics and comfort.Beyond the home's stunning interior is a lush, well-maintained backyard featuring a sparkling pool - an oasis perfect for summer gatherings, barbecues, or simply soaking in the sun.The location of 41 Groton Street is nothing short of idyllic. A short stroll brings you to the shoreline and the scenic Great Kills Park. Moreover, shops, schools, and public transportation are conveniently close, making for an easy lifestyle. Flood insurance is required. Annual flood insurance is $4410
